Contacta con nosotros

Temario del curso

Primeros pasos

  • Sintaxis básica
  • Idiomas
  • Convenciones de codificación

Fundamentos

  • Tipos básicos
  • Paquetes
  • Flujo de control
  • Retornos y saltos

Clases y objetos

  • Clases e herencia
  • Propiedades y campos
  • Interfaces
  • Modificadores de visibilidad
  • Extensiones
  • Clases de datos
  • Genéricos
  • Clases anidadas
  • Clases de enumeración
  • Objetos
  • Delegación
  • Propiedades delegadas

Funciones y lambdas

  • Funciones
  • Lambdas
  • Funciones en línea

Otros

  • Declaraciones de descomposición
  • Colecciones
  • Rangos
  • Comprobaciones y conversiones de tipo
  • Expresiones this
  • Igualdad
  • Sobrecarga de operadores
  • Seguridad nula
  • Excepciones
  • Annotations
  • Reflexión
  • Constructores seguros de tipo
  • Tipo dinámico

Interoperabilidad

  • Llamar a Java desde Kotlin
  • Llamar a Kotlin desde Java

Referencia

  • Documentación del código Kotlin
  • Uso de Maven
  • Uso de Ant
  • Uso de Gradle
  • Kotlin y OSGi

Tutoriales

Requerimientos

Kotlin es un lenguaje de programación de tipado estático para JVM, Android y el navegador.

Público objetivo

Este curso está dirigido a programadores e ingenieros interesados en la programación con Kotlin.

 21 Horas

Número de participantes


Precio por participante

Testimonios (4)

Próximos cursos

Categorías Relacionadas